February 5, 2014 www.DesertMessenger.com 31 Food bank seeks donations Quartzsite Food Bank is asking for donations during this busy winter season. Demands are increasing as more families go without. Please drop off your non-perishable food items at the Quartzsite Food Bank on Moon Mountain Ave., just north of the Senior Center or in convenient drop boxes at participating Quartzsite businesses. Thank you. Download eBooks from Quartzsite Library Download eBooks, audiobooks, and more on your computer, mobile device, iPod, or eBook reader from your local library. All you need is an Inter- net connection and a library card. Remember, it's a loan which does expire, so don't procrastinate reading your books from the library. It's an automated return with no late fees. There are a variety of subjects to choose from.
